This evening 7th and 8th grade students from Bridgeport Catholic Academy and the Nativity of Our Lord Saint Gabriel Parish were Christmas Caroling. They started on the church steps of Nativity of Our Lord. After a few songs outside, strong winds and the wind chill temperature at 12 degrees they moved indoor. The quire director, Merry Bell a humanities teacher at both the BCA and Saint Gabriel did a wonderful job at pulling it all together for a magical sound.




It was awesome
